Hatfield restaurant offering respite, free meals for displaced Hatfield Village Apartments residents

As firefighters battled a major 3-alarm apartment fire at Hatfield Village Apartments in Hatfield Township, a restaurant in neighboring Hatfield Borough has offered up a place for those affected from the blaze to regroup and get a free meal.

"We are heartbroken to hear about the fire ,,, and the devastating losses our neighbors are facing," wrote Poppy's Tavern on Facebook. "If you were directly impacted, please know that our doors are open to you."

Poppy's Tavern said the restaurant is a place for residents or first responders to come in, take a moment to regroup, and get served a free meal on Thursday.

"Our community is strongest when we stand together, and we're here for you," wrote Poppy's Tavern.

The Hatfield restaurant at the old Hattricks Sports Bar & Grill location on Lincoln Avenue is owned by Shane and and Jessica Dawson. They opened their bar and restaurant in September 2024.

    


Poppy’s Tavern offers a menu, with a variety of foods and cuisines, and the usual burgers and cheesesteaks, as well as an updated, modernized beer selection – like Free Will Brewing, Fiddlehead Brewing, Dogfish Head Brewery, and Konig Ludwig. 

The tavern has 18 rotating taps inside and six taps outside on its full pet-friendly outside bar. Takeout beer is also available.

According to its website, Poppy's Tavern's goal is to give back to the communities of Hatfield, Souderton, Harleysville, Towamencin and beyond. It partners with children's groups, pet rescues and other local organizations for events and activities.

It offers private events in an outdoor party space and live music and events.
